TM10774 Titanium Alloy Custom Part Ti-0.3Mo-0.8Ni Grade 12 UNS R53400

Catalogue Number TM10774
Material Ti-0.3Mo-0.8Ni
Grade Grade 12, UNS R53400
Form Customized

Titanium Alloy Custom Part Ti-0.3Mo-0.8Ni Grade 12 UNS R53400 is a precisely engineered titanium component with controlled alloying elements for improved performance. Stanford Advanced Materials (SAM) applies systematic metallurgical analysis and rigorous microstructural inspection using advanced electron microscopy. Quality control focuses on compositional accuracy and dimensional precision, ensuring consistency in specialised custom parts for demanding engineering applications.

What specific processing methods are recommended for achieving optimal microstructure in this titanium alloy?

The alloy benefits from controlled thermomechanical treatments, including hot isostatic pressing and recrystallisation annealing. These processes refine grain structure and enhance mechanical stability. For detailed process parameters, refer to SAM’s technical guidelines.

How does the Ti-0.3Mo-0.8Ni composition affect corrosion resistance compared to conventional titanium alloys?

The addition of molybdenum and nickel in controlled proportions enhances resistance to oxidation and pitting corrosion under high temperatures and aggressive environments. This composition improves performance in applications where chemical inertness is critical.
